THE BBC expects to start digital radio broadcasts in London next autumn, providing compact disc quality audio for car radios able to pick up the signal and for portable sets, writes Maggie Brown.
The move is designed to encourage the spread of new broadcasting technology and the manufacture and marketing of new low-cost receivers. The BBC hopes to extend the network service to cover most urban areas and motorways by 1998.
